The new surgical assistant wasn't going to last long, likely wouldn't make it to lunch. That's what Foghorn Jackson thought, anyway. Foghorn had only been with the Mad Popes organization for five weeks and was already the senior assistant for the team's mysterious doctor running the Department of Innovative Cycloptic Kinetics beneath the concourse level at the Basilica at Muskrat Slough.

The surgeon, whose name Foghorn never learned, had went through sixteen other aspiring assistants. Six were let go within the first hour of their first day for voicing concerns about the surgical room sharing space with the stadium's concessions storage. Another four stormed out during the first procedure they assisted on because of personal principles or ethics concerns. The non-disclosure agreement each of them signed the morning of their hiring kept them from bringing any of their angsts to the state medical board, that or the exit interview with the green-eyed surgeon and the organization's assistant general manager. Foghorn had no idea what questions they were asking the departing hires, but every one of them left with hollow expressions and never said a word or looked at anyone as they were escorted from the ballpark, regardless how fired up they might have been entering the exit interview.

Foghorn couldn't have cared less about any of them, anyway. The job was the best thing that had happened to him for years, and the expectations were simple: don't ask questions, don't make suggestions, and clean up every last speck of blood, fecal matter, or bodily fluid before the next ballplayer was gurneyed into the room.

"His name is pronounced fuckin' Goes-In-You, you believe that shit?" The new, soon to be old, assistant said, his crisp blue surgical mask tucked under his chin despite Foghorn repeatedly pointing to his own pulled-up mask. "Like Goes in You. This bastard should be slapping asses in porn rather than slapping singles for this shit organization, am I right?"

Foghorn, of course, didn't respond. The green-eyed surgeon had a way of always knowing what was said in this room. Foghorn had searched for a recording device every time he cleaned the room but had so far come away without finding anything.

"Can't believe we signed this discarded piece of Surfer trash." The assistant lifted Geauxinue's arm into the air, let it go, and laughed as it slammed hard onto the surgical table. "Everyone knows the air down there has a way of corroding away the human body until it's nothing but a fuckin' shell of what it once ..."

The door swung open, and the green-eyed surgeon walked in. Foghorn looked forward to how this new assistant would react to his quick firing.

Instead of immediately taking him for his exit interview, though, the surgeon said sternly, "Tell me more about this air down in Long Beach."

"The air? Well shit, doc. The air is just a way of saying that Long Beach is where players go to die, so to fuckin' speak. Look what happened to our boy Carlos Flores. Dude found second life here until that idiot shoeless," the assistant made the sign of the cross, "passed him off to @Lane down in Long Beach who quickly destroyed the poor fucker."

"Corrosion. You said something of corrosion."

"Well yeah, doc. Players fuckin' age like shit down there -- fallin' apart like a @RonCo team in the playoffs [author's note: obligatory reference]. Me and my boys are sure there's something in the air or gotta be in those rusty pipes beneath that old cattle barn they call a stadium. Kind of an urban legend kind of thing to never wash your hands when you have to watch a game there. A guy's hands don't feel right for a week. I swear my buddy Kenny washed his hands down there because he wasn't fuckin' thinking, and, anyway, his girl spent a week down in the hospital getting her fancy parts fixed up because Kenny got a little handsy and finger..."

The green-eyed surgeon raised a hand and the new assistant stopped. She turned to Foghorn and pointed at Geauxinue on the table, "Monitor this man and prep him for tomorrow morning. 6:00 am. We'll do the surgery then."

She turned back to the new assistant. "You, with me."
